Tadashi Yoshida
Summary
Tadashi Yoshida is a human[1]. He was born in Sukegawa[2]. He was born on January 20, 1921[3]. He died on June 10, 1998[4]. He worked as a composer[5].

Recognition
Awards received include Medal with Purple Ribbon[9], a grade of an order[32], in Japan[33], founded in 1955[34] and People's Honour Award[10], an award[35], in Japan[36], founded in 1977[37].
Death and Burial
Tadashi Yoshida died on June 10, 1998[4]. The cause of death was pneumonia[15].
